{"product_id":"malcolm-x-encyclopedia","title":"Malcolm X Encyclopedia","description":"\u003cp\u003eUsing the Nation of Islam as a vehicle, but largely through his own dedication, energy, and intelligence, Malcolm X became an indefatigable Black leader during the 1960s. This encyclopedic volume examines one of the most controversial and heroic leaders of the 20th century. Over 500 essays discuss how Malcolm X affected the world in which he lived and how the influence of people, issues, and events shaped his development as an international figure.\u003c\/p\u003e\u003cp\u003e\u003c\/p\u003e\u003cp\u003eWith more than 70 contributors from black studies, history, political science, sociology, philosophy, education, journalism, and psychology, the encyclopedia combines the knowledge of a precise group of writers. Addressing a major social, religious, and political figure through their own disciplines, these authors flesh out both the diversity and the complexity of the world that defined Malcolm X.\u003c\/p\u003e","brand":"Bloomsbury Publishing Plc","offers":[{"title":"Default Product","offer_id":54219445109080,"sku":"9780313292644","price":72.99,"currency_code":"EUR","in_stock":true}],"url":"https:\/\/agendabookshop.com\/products\/malcolm-x-encyclopedia","provider":"Agenda Bookshop","version":"1.0","type":"link"}
